It took me about almost a week to get it working on my win 7 x64, and I thought i would never get it to work and i finally got it to work almost when i was about to give up. the problem i was having was that windows wasn't installing the Samsung MITs usb driver when my phone was connected to the computer. Then I was fooling around with my phone settings to see if there was something that needed to be changed. So i disabled the Enable advanced network functionality option and it immediately started to download and install the Samsung MITs usb driver. Then i was able to switch the driver with the one provided in the guide which was a little tricky because it has to detect that driver when your shut down your phone and it begins charging.

Yeah, it most definitely does work on win 7 x64. First make sure you get the driver to install. Then make sure to run octans in xp sp3 mode. Octans will report the OS it thinks it's running under in the box at the bottom. What exactly is the issue?
